The Importance of iOS Updates

iOS updates are crucial for maintaining the integrity and performance of iPhones. Each update typically brings a mix of new features, improvements, and bug fixes. Security updates, like those speculated for iOS 18.3.1, are particularly vital as they protect devices from vulnerabilities that could be exploited by malicious actors. These updates ensure that users have the latest protections against malware, data breaches, and other cyber threats.

Security is a top priority for Apple. The company frequently releases updates to patch any discovered vulnerabilities, which can range from minor issues to critical flaws that could allow unauthorized access to sensitive data. The proactive approach to updating software is a cornerstone of Apple’s strategy to enhance user trust and device reliability.

How iOS Updates Are Implemented

When a new iOS version is released, users receive a notification on their devices, prompting them to download the update. This process typically involves several steps:

1. Downloading the Update: Once the user selects to update, the iPhone connects to Apple's servers to download the necessary files. This download size can vary based on the nature of the update.

2. Installation: After downloading, the user initiates the installation, which can take several minutes. The device may restart during this process, and users are advised to have ample battery life or to connect their device to a power source.

3. Post-Installation Configuration: Once installed, the iPhone may require additional configuration or updates to apps to ensure compatibility with the new operating system version.

The Principles Behind iOS Development

The development of iOS updates like 18.3.1 is rooted in a sophisticated framework that includes continuous monitoring, assessment, and enhancement of system security. Apple employs a combination of automated tools and manual reviews to identify vulnerabilities. This proactive stance allows Apple to quickly address potential threats.

Moreover, Apple’s security model is built on a series of principles, including:

  • Sandboxing: Apps run in isolated environments, minimizing the risk of one app affecting another or accessing sensitive system resources without permission.
  • Regular Security Audits: Apple conducts regular audits of its software, identifying and patching vulnerabilities before they can be exploited.
  • User Transparency: Users are informed about the nature of updates, including what issues are being addressed, which fosters trust in the platform.
